Fiji’s visitor arrivals remain on the rise in 2018, peaking at an all new record of over 870,000.

This was highlighted by Prime Minister Voreqe Bainimarama while officiating at the ANZ Fiji Excellence in Tourism Awards at Sofitel in Nadi.

Bainimarama also revealed that in July alone, Fiji passed 95,000 visitor arrivals, a new single‑month high for Fijian tourism.

The Prime Minister reiterated to those present at the awards that the contribution from tourism in Fiji is more than dollars and cents.

He adds that as leaders in tourism, those working in the industry are on the frontlines of putting Fiji on the map, and give our visitors that special feeling of family and friendship that can only be found in Fiji, among the Fijian people.

Bainimarama also highlighted that Fijian tourism is now a 1.9‑billion‑dollar industry and is well on pace to hit our 2.2‑billion‑dollar goal in 2021. 

Meanwhile the Fiji Excellence in Tourism Awards has given the prestigious Lifetime Achievement award to two individuals, Michael Dennis and Bill Whiting while the late Patrick ‘Paddy’ Doyle was given the Visionary Award.

FETA Trustee Dixon Seeto says both Dennis and Whiting have contributed immensely towards the growth of our tourism industry.

Seeto said the board of trustees also wanted to remember the late Paddy Doyle as a pioneer of Fiji’s tourism industry.

Other individual awards were given to Britney Turaganikeli who was recognised as the Fiji Pride Champion, Akuila Batiweti is the Emerging Tourism Leader and Rosie Holidays Eroni Puamau received the Tourism Leader Award.

The Hall of Fame awards were given to Outrigger Fiji Beach Resort and Rosie Holidays.
